Microsoft’s Project Tye aims to tame microservices development

Discovering it difficult to perform with microservices? With Project Tye, Microsoft is presenting an experimental developer instrument intended to make it less complicated to construct, examination, and deploy microservices and dispersed programs.

Microsoft believes Project Tye, a .Net Basis project launched Could 21, will simplicity widespread pain factors developers face when making programs that talk to a databases or that are comprised of various expert services that talk with each and every other. Project Tye is intended to make it less complicated for developers to operate various application components simultaneously and to deploy dispersed applications to platforms this sort of as Kubernetes. 

The main ambitions of Project Tye include:

  • Simplifying microservices progress by operating several expert services with a single command, making use of dependencies in containers, and exploring addresses of other expert services by making use of uncomplicated conventions.
  • Automating deployment of .Net programs to Kubernetes by instantly containerizing these programs, building Kubernetes manifests with nominal configuration, and making use of a single configuration file.

Project Tye is becoming explained as an experiment that will previous at minimum right up until November 2020, when .Net five ships. It will be re-evaluated at that time. In the meantime, new options are to be unveiled about just about every four months.

Development options will be oriented towards area progress, with developers encouraged to steer clear of operating Project Tye in a container except vital. Microsoft is fascinated in creating Tye deployable to a range of runtime environments.

Project Tye involves .Net Core 3.one. It can be installed as a world wide instrument making use of the adhering to command:

dotnet instrument set up -g Microsoft.Tye --model ".2.-alpha.20258.3"

Microsoft also has posted instructions for operating single and various expert services making use of Tye alongside with tips on deploying to Kubernetes.

Copyright © 2020 IDG Communications, Inc.